Glutamate ionotropic receptor AMPA type subunit 1 (GRIA1)

Target
GRIA1
Molecular classification
Ionotropic glutamate receptor, AMPA receptor, Ligand-gated ion channel
01

Overview

GRIA1 encodes a subunit of the ionotropic glutamate receptors of the AMPA type, which mediate fast excitatory synaptic transmission in the central nervous system. These receptors play critical roles in synaptic plasticity, underlying learning and memory. Dysfunction or altered expression of GRIA1 has been implicated in various neurological diseases.
